Hillside, the popular annual music festival held on Guelph Lake Island in Guelph, Ont., has revealed who'll perform at this year's event from July 24 to 26.
Schedules haven't been confirmed, but Arkells, Attack In Black, Dave Bidini, Bruce Peninsula, Final Fantasy, Gentleman Reg, Great Lake Swimmers, Hey Rosetta!, Holy Fuck, Julie Doiron, Pilot Speed, Rock Plaza Central, Skydiggers, Tokyo Police Club, The Waking Eyes, Patrick Watson, Women and Woodhands are among the acts who'll take part.
Weekend and Saturday passes are sold out, while Friday evening and Sunday passes are still available from the Hillside office, ticketpro.ca and by phone at 1-866-598-4455.
Those who camp on site for the weekend or visit for the day can also check out music workshops, food and craft vendors. More information on the weekend is available on the Hillside website.
